2014 SESSION
SB 322 Human trafficking, Commission on Prevention of; established, report.
Introduced by: Adam P. Ebbin |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Human trafficking; legislative commission created; study; report. Creates a legislative commission for the purpose of developing and implementing a State Plan for the Prevention of Human Trafficking. The commission will expire in two years.
